Guía de Octave

En esta guía te hablo sobre GNU Octave, un software libre y de código abierto similar a Matlab que te permite resolver cálculos matemáticos y problemas geométricos (por ejemplo, matrices, álgebra lineal, análisis matemático, etc.).
Cómo usar Octave

¿Cuáles son las fortalezas de Octave?

  • Es gratis. Puedes instalarlo y usarlo libremente. No requiere registro.
  • Se puede instalar en una PC con sistema operativo Windows, Linux o Mac.
  • Los comandos de Octave son muy similares a Matlab. La sintaxis es casi idéntica.

¿Cómo usar Octave?

Puedes usar Octave de dos maneras diferentes

  • como calculadora científica a través de la línea de comandos
  • como lenguaje de programación para escribir y guardar archivos de script

Esta es la GUI de Octave

interfaz de Octave

El menú principal de Octave(File, Edit, Debug, Window, Help, News) está en la parte superior

En la parte central de la interfaz está la ventana de comandos (command window) que le permite usar Octave de forma interactiva

A la izquierda hay varios paneles:

  • file manager ( gestor de archivos )
  • workspace ( espacio de trabajo )
  • command history ( comandos históricos )

En la barra en la parte inferior se encuentra el elemento Editor que le permite escribir y guardar scripts en Octave.

cómo escribir un script

Cómo instalar GNU Octave

Puedes descargar el archivo de instalación directamente en el sitio web oficial www.gnu.org/software/octave/

Está disponible para cualquier sistema operativo de PC: Linux, Windows, MacOS, BSD

sitio web de GNU Octave

Si usas Linux, también puedes encontrarlo entre las aplicaciones que se pueden instalar en los distintos repositorios.

En esta guía explicaré algunos ejemplos prácticos de uso de Octave.

  • Cómo realizar operaciones matemáticas elementales
    Conoce los operadores matemáticos utilizados por Octave para realizar operaciones matemáticas básicas.
    operaciones matemáticas elementales en Octave
  • Cómo hacer la aproximación racional de un número real
    En esta lección, explicaré cómo transformar un número real en una suma de fracciones.
    aproximación racional
  • ¿Cómo se escribe pi, infinito, unidad imaginaria o número de Euler?
    Octave utiliza constantes predefinidas específicas para indicar pi, el símbolo de infinito, el número de Euler y la unidad imaginaria.
    algunas constantes matemáticas en Octave
  • Cómo calcular logaritmos
    En esta lección, explicaré cómo calcular logaritmos naturales, logaritmos con base 10 o 2 utilizando las funciones predefinidas de Octave, y cómo calcular logaritmos con cualquier otra base.
    los logaritmos en Octave
  • Cómo realizar operaciones con números complejos
    En esta guía, explicaré cómo realizar operaciones matemáticas con números complejos.
    números complejos en Octave
  • Cómo calcular el límite de una función
    En esta lección, explicaré cómo calcular el límite de una función para x que tiende a un punto o a más o menos infinito.
    cómo hacer un límite de función en Octave
  • Cómo calcular la derivada de una función
    En esta guía te explico cómo calcular la primera, segunda o enésima derivada de una función.
    como hacer una derivada de funcion en Octave
  • Cálculo de integrales indefinidas (antiderivadas)
    En esta lección, exploraremos el proceso de determinar la integral indefinida de una función.
  • Cálculo de integrales indefinidas (antiderivadas) en Octave Aprenderemos cómo calcular la integral indefinida de una función utilizando Octave.

  • Cómo calcular la integral definida de una función
    En esta lección, aprenderemos cómo calcular la integral definida de una función entre dos límites de integración.
    Cálculo de integrales definidas en Octave Utilizando Octave, aprenderemos cómo calcular la integral definida de una función.
  • Cómo encontrar la solución de una ecuación diferencial
    En esta lección, explicaré cómo calcular la solución de una ecuación diferencial homogénea o no homogénea de primer o segundo orden.
    Resolución de ecuaciones diferenciales en Octave Utilizando Octave, aprenderemos cómo resolver ecuaciones diferenciales de primer y segundo orden.
  • Cómo crear un vector
    En esta lección, aprenderemos cómo definir un vector en Octave y las principales operaciones con vectores.
    Operaciones con vectores en Octave
  • Cómo crear matrices
    En esta lección, demostraré cómo crear una matriz cuadrada o rectangular utilizando Octave.
    Creación de matrices en Octave
  • Resolución de un sistema de ecuaciones lineales
    IEn esta lección, te guiaré en el proceso de resolución de un sistema de ecuaciones lineales utilizando cálculo vectorial en Octave para determinar las soluciones.

 
 

Segnalami un errore, un refuso o un suggerimento per migliorare gli appunti

FacebookTwitterLinkedinLinkedin

Octave

FAQ